The first step in building an efficient processing line is selecting the right types of machinery for your specific needs. Each machine is designed to handle a unique part of the process, and together they form a cohesive system that transforms raw produce into finished goods.

Cleaning and Preparation Machines

At the start of the line, washing machines are indispensable. These machines use high-pressure water jets and nozzles to remove dirt, pesticides, and debris from fruits and vegetables. Some advanced models even include brushes for tougher residues. Following washing, peeling machines take over, efficiently removing skins from products like potatoes, apples, and carrots—saving time compared to manual peeling.

Cutting and Slicing Equipment

Once produce is clean and peeled, cutting machines, slicing machines, and dicing machines shape it into the desired form. Whether you need uniform slices for chips, diced pieces for salads, or specific cuts for canning, these machines use sharp blades and precise controls to ensure consistency. Many are adjustable, allowing you to switch between different sizes without extensive retooling.

Processing and Preservation Machinery

For products like juices, juicing machines extract liquid while separating pulp, ensuring a smooth texture. After processing, preserving the produce becomes key. Drying machines use heating elements to remove moisture, extending shelf life for items like dried fruits and herbs. Meanwhile, freezing machines with powerful cooling elements lock in freshness for frozen vegetables and pre-cut fruit mixes.

Packaging and Conveying Systems

No processing line is complete without packaging machines and conveying systems. Conveyor belts move products seamlessly between stations, reducing manual handling and speeding up production. Packaging machines then seal products in bags, boxes, or containers, keeping them fresh and ready for distribution.

Key Components That Keep Your Machinery Running

Behind every efficient processing line are key components that ensure reliability and performance. Understanding these parts can help you maintain equipment and troubleshoot issues.
Motors are the workhorses of any machine, powering everything from conveyor belts to blades. Choosing high-quality motors reduces downtime and energy costs. Hoppers hold raw materials, feeding them into machines at a steady rate to prevent jams. Control panels let operators adjust settings like speed and temperature, while sensors monitor conditions to ensure safety and consistency. Valves regulate the flow of liquids, such as water in washing machines or juice in juicing machines, preventing waste and ensuring precision.

A Step-by-Step Guide to Fruit and Vegetable Processing

Every processing line follows a logical sequence of processing steps, starting from harvest to the final product.

From Farm to Facility

Harvesting is the first step, where ripe produce is collected and transported to the processing facility. Timing is crucial here—harvesting too early or late affects quality. Once at the facility, washing removes contaminants, followed by peeling to prepare produce for further processing.

Shaping and Transforming

Next comes cutting, slicing, or dicing, depending on the product. These steps create uniform pieces that cook evenly or fit neatly into packages. For liquid products, juicing extracts the desired liquid, with excess pulp often repurposed into other items like jams.

Preservation and Quality Control

Drying and freezing are common preservation methods, each suited to different products. Drying works well for fruits and herbs, while freezing is ideal for vegetables and pre-prepared mixes. After preservation, quality inspection ensures products meet standards for taste, texture, and safety. Finally, packaging protects products during shipping and storage, completing the process.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

  1. What’s the difference between a slicing machine and a dicing machine?
A slicing machine cuts produce into thin, flat pieces, while a dicing machine creates cube-shaped pieces. Both are adjustable for different sizes, but their blade configurations differ to achieve specific shapes.
  1. How often should I replace key components like blades and conveyor belts?
Blades should be sharpened or replaced every 200–500 hours of use, depending on the product. Conveyor belts last 1–3 years with regular cleaning and maintenance, though heavy use may require more frequent replacement.
  1. Can the same processing line handle both fruits and vegetables?
Yes, many machines are versatile enough for both. However, adjust settings like blade speed and washing pressure for delicate fruits (e.g., berries) versus harder vegetables (e.g., carrots) to avoid damage.
